How much does it cost to move in Schaumburg?

Moving costs in Schaumburg can range from affordable to premium, depending on the size of your move and the distance involved. Whether youre relocating locally or long-distance, understanding the average moving costs in Schaumburg will help you plan your budget more effectively.

Check out our breakdown of the average costs for moving a studio, 1-bedroom apartment, or 3-bedroom house in Schaumburg. You can also explore our moving cost calculator to get an estimate tailored to your specific needs.

Moving costs in Schaumburg

Move SizeAverage Cost
Studio/1-bedroom$2,250
2-bedroom apartment$5,250
3-bedroom house$8,500

Schaumburg

The moving industry in Schaumburg, Illinois, supports a suburban community of approximately 78,000 residents and a thriving business district. Residential relocations are common, involving single-family homes, townhouses, and apartment complexes. Most moves require two to three movers using trucks sized between 20 and 26 feet, with average job durations running between 4 to 6 hours for typical local or regional moves. Schaumburg’s well-planned road network and access to major highways—such as I-290, I-355, and I-90—facilitate efficient service within the village and to nearby communities like Hoffman Estates and Arlington Heights. Seasonal peaks in moving activity coincide with summer months and academic calendar transitions. Commercial moves contribute significantly, especially in sectors like retail, corporate offices, and healthcare. Moving providers in the area offer services including packing, storage options, and specialized item handling. Competitive market conditions ensure Schaumburg’s residents and businesses have access to reliable, professional relocation solutions tailored to the needs of both households and local enterprises.
